The worst xiao long bao’s ever. Dumplings were all shrivelled up, there was no taste, just very bad fatty pork, AND the meat was still raw inside. Horrible experience.Food: 1/5
Actually atrocious, this is not representative of Hong Kong food at all. The shallot pancakes had so much dough and yet tasted like nothing barely any oil and were so tough; the combination noodle soup literally smelled and tasted like the plastic bowl that it came in, which is unheard of; and the mushroom noodles were way too salty and noodles were clumpy. The only saving grace was the atmosphere of the place. Would not recommend this to anyone. You're better off eating anywhere else tbh

Disgusting. Just ordered 4, tiny xiao long bao, they were clearly store bought and frozen. $12, inedible, one was definitely rotten. Staff hygiene is non existent, no hair nets, no gloves, wiping their faces with their hands and then touching the food... So gross...Food: 1/5
Not good and wayyyyyyy overpriced. $11.90 for 4 xiaolongbao, which I'm guessing were mass manufactured and frozen. They weren't awful, I didn't get food poisoning, but certainly not worth nearly $3 each. By comparison $12 would buy you a proper meal at any other stall at spice alley, or almost twice as many xiaolongbaos at Dintaifung, which are 20x better. Don't waste your money.
